Diffractive Dijet Production with a Leading Proton in ep Collisions at HERA
Abstract
The production of dijets with a tagged forward proton is measured at HERA. The data were recorded with the H1 detector at DESY in the years 2006-2007. Events with a leading proton are detected using the very forward proton spectrometer of the H1 detector. Two jets are selected with transverse momenta transverse momenta in the hadronic-centre-of-mass larger than 4 and 5.5GeV, respectively. The analysis is performed both in the regime of deep-inelastic scattering (DIS), with momentum transfer $Q{^2} > 4$ GeV${^2}$ and for photoproduction ({\gamma}p), with $Q{^2} < 2$ GeV${^2}$. Cross sections are measured single-differentially in various kinematic quantities. For DIS, the data are found to be in good agreement with NLO QCD calculations based on diffractive parton densities determined from inclusive diffractive cross section measurements. For {\gamma}p, the cross sections are found to be overestimated by approximately a factor of two.
